Oil Prices Increase Following Trump's Threat Amid US-Iran Peace Talks
21 Haziran 2026Bloomberg
- Oil prices increased following President Donald Trump's warning of potential military action against Iran if Hezbollah continues its aggression towards Israel. This development has sparked worries regarding the ongoing peace negotiations between the United States and Iran.
- The situation remains volatile as geopolitical tensions influence market dynamics.
- Tensions in the Middle East have historically affected oil prices, and Trump's comments come at a time when peace talks between the US and Iran are crucial for regional stability. - The rise in oil prices reflects the market's sensitivity to geopolitical risks, particularly in the Middle East. Trump's threats may not only impact oil supply but also signal a broader instability that could affect global markets.
